The Journal of the Royal Society recently published the results of a survey which demonstrates the supremacy of sea freight in world trade.  The Survey tracked the movement of 16 636 cargo vessels around the world, and showed the complexity of an industry which moved 7.4 bn tonnes of freight in 2006.  The ports which recorded the highest number of shipping movements were Shanghai and Singapore.
